AFL vs DFS: by the numbers

  • AFL is the larger company ($59.96B vs $50.34B market cap).
  • DFS trades at the lower earnings multiple (10.67 vs 13.45 P/E).
  • AFL converts more revenue to profit (25.44% vs 21.65% net margin).
  • DFS grew revenue faster over the past five years (13.84% vs -4.37% CAGR).
  • AFL pays the higher dividend yield (2.02% vs 1.40%).
